Brushed Stainless Modular Under Stairs Wine Cabinet
Brushed Stainless Modular Under Stairs Wine Cabinet
VinotempVinotemp
This beautiful, hand-made custom wine cabinet takes advantage of the unused space under the stairs. Insulated glass doors with brushed stainless trim and pole handles offer modern appeal to the room. Metal racking holds bottles securely in place while two Wine Mate Cooling Systems ensure the entire collection is stored at the right temperature and humidity. By Vinotemp International

Outbuilding Home Office
Outbuilding Home Office
Pamela Dailey DesignPamela Dailey Design
In the backyard of a home dating to 1910 in the Hudson Valley, a modest 250 square-foot outbuilding, at one time used as a bootleg moonshine distillery, and more recently as a bare bones man-cave, was given new life as a sumptuous home office replete with not only its own WiFi, but also abundant southern light brought in by new windows, bespoke furnishings, a double-height workstation, and a utilitarian loft. The original barn door slides open to reveal a new set of sliding glass doors opening into the space. Dark hardwood floors are a foil to crisp white defining the walls and ceiling in the lower office, and soft shell pink in the double-height volume punctuated by charcoal gray barn stairs and iron pipe railings up to a dollhouse-like loft space overhead. The desktops -- clad on the top surface only with durable, no-nonsense, mushroom-colored laminate -- leave birch maple edges confidently exposed atop punchy red painted bases perforated with circles for visual and functional relief. Overhead a wrought iron lantern alludes to a birdcage, highlighting the feeling of being among the treetops when up in the loft.

Verona Center Hall Colonial
Verona Center Hall Colonial
CBH ArchitectsCBH Architects
Foyer in center hall colonial. Wallpaper was removed and a striped paint treatment executed with different sheens of the same color. Wainscoting was added and handrail stained ebony. New geometric runner replaced worn blue carpet.
Staircase and Painted Doors, Frames and Baseboard
Staircase and Painted Doors, Frames and Baseboard
R&J Painting LLCR&J Painting LLC
Sanded all Wood Oil Primed all Risers, Stringer and Flat Wood on Posts Painted all Risers, Stringer and Flat Wood on Posts in White Semi-Gloss Stained and Polyurethaned Decorative Oak on Posts and Handrail in Ebony
